At the typical $65 per hour, a handyman might make $600 to $700 for a long day's work, however completing a task priced at $1,000 in one day would result in a greater per-hour rate. Handymen in upscale markets might cost more each day than in other locations, while saturated markets may imply a lower income.
The concern is whether you want them to. Licensing laws for handymen and for electrical work differ state by state. A handyman near you who is accredited to do electrical work will either have the license readily available for display or your state will have the electrical credentials noted on the handyman's license.
This varies by state and licensure requirements. Electrical codes are locally based, so it's crucial that your handyman understands the codes and authorization requirements. The only method to understand what electrical work a handyman can lawfully do is by checking your state licensing standards and asking a handyman you're thinking about hiring for proof of licensing.

From small painting jobs and light component setup, the Handy app is focused around jobs that are best fit for property handymen. It works by connecting clients with service companies and deals with vetting, payments, and reservations. To utilize Convenient, you have to apply to be a pro and meet particular requirements, like having paid work experience in the services you plan to provide.

DEWALT Mobile Pro DEWALT Mobile Pro is a handyman's dream app. It features a variety of various building calculators that you can utilize to approximate the products you require for a task, like paint or wood, as well as access to ebooks and digital resources for on-the-job assistance. DEWALT mobile pro is free to download and utilize.

Regardless of what you might hope, seeing duplicated episodes of "Home Brothers" doesn't precisely make you an expert in home repair or renovation. For those people who are not the handiest or do it yourself savvy, it's a requirement to employ somebody to tackle projects like altering lights, painting the walls, or setting up an appliance.
What to Avoid When Employing a Handyman Although it's tempting to employ your neighbor's child to repair the drywall in the basement, what you save in the short-term might wind up costing you more in the long run if he does the job improperly or haphazardly. Even if you're hiring a handyman for the easiest jobs, it's still vital to guarantee that they are qualified to do the task which they have a great deal of experience with house repair work in general.
